  • What is your favorite word in your language and why?

    Although it's rather simple on the surface, I like the word "get". It can be used in so many different ways, and in so many different situations. Besides "to receive", you can use it with different prepositions to create really specific and sometimes complex ideas and concepts. For example, "get with it" is a command that tells someone to try to understand what's happening, but also carries with it a bit of a criticism of the person who doesn't quite understand the concept yet. That's a lot of meaning conveyed with just a few simple words, and that's just one example. There are dozens more with the word "get".
